Handover — Gridsmith crossword generator

On-call notes: generator runs nightly at 02:00. If the fill solver stalls, kill the job; it auto-resumes from the last checkpoint. Dictionary updates land Mondays — expect longer runs then. Don't touch the theme queue manually; Petra owns it. Alerts over 20 min runtime are real. Current runtime settings are shown below.

deployment values, fahap-hahaf:
[casdor]
port = 9200
region = south-2
host = casdor.qirvanworks.corp
timeout_ms = 3000
retries = 4

## Seat-Map Renderer (Orpheum Hall)

Renderer draws the full house as SVG tiles, virtualizing rows beyond the viewport. Hold timers and repaint throttles are server-driven; don't hardcode. If tiles flicker during high-demand onsales, check the throttle values first, then the hold TTL. The tuning constants currently in effect are as follows.

tuning constants:
QUOTAS = {
    "druwyn": 5,
    "holix": 5,
    "zorath": 5,
    "holwyn": 10,
}

### Action item: bound the Glimmercache image cache

Root cause: decoded bitmaps were retained by the preview carousel past eviction, so the LRU count dropped while resident memory grew. Fix lands in two parts: weak references for carousel holds, and a hard byte ceiling with pressure-triggered purge. Maintainers: do not raise the ceiling without profiling on low-memory devices first. Current eviction thresholds are the constants below.

tuning table, kajog-bawip:
TIERS = {
    "kelius": 256,
    "lammir": 543,
}